"نحن نعيش في عالم رائع مليء بالجمال والسحر والمغامرة"
Quote meaning
Think about the world around you. It's easy to get caught up in the daily grind, feeling like every day is just a repeat of the one before. But if you take a step back, you'll see that our world is truly amazing. It's packed with incredible sights, fascinating people, and all sorts of adventures waiting for you. It’s saying, don't forget to appreciate the beauty and excitement that life offers.
So, where did this idea come from? Well, it's something that's been echoed through the ages by explorers, poets, and everyday folks who’ve stopped to smell the roses, so to speak. The quote reminds me of the words of explorers like Marco Polo or modern-day travelers who see the world not just as a place to live but as a place to explore and marvel at.
Let me give you a real-life example. Think about Jane Goodall — the renowned primatologist. She ventured into the Tanzanian forests at a time when the thought of a young woman living with wild chimpanzees was beyond most people's imagination. Her journey wasn't just about scientific discovery. It was about seeing the beauty and charm of the chimpanzees' world, understanding their social structures, and appreciating the subtle nuances of their lives. Her adventure opened our eyes to the wonders of animal behavior and the importance of conservation.
So, what can you do with this wisdom? Start small. Make it a habit to notice the little things. The colors of the sunset, the laughter of children playing in the park, the intricate patterns on a butterfly's wings. Dive into a book that takes you to another world, or take up a hobby that pushes your boundaries. Travel if you can — even if it's just to a nearby town where you’ve never been. Talk to people from different walks of life and listen to their stories. Each of these experiences can add a layer of richness to your life, showing you just how amazing our world is.
Here's a scenario to bring it home. Imagine you're stuck in a rut at work, feeling like every day is just about getting through the tasks. One weekend, you decide to take a spontaneous trip to a local farmer's market. As you wander through the stalls, you meet a beekeeper who tells you all about the intricate life of bees and how they contribute to our ecosystem. You taste honey that's unlike any you've ever had, and you watch a little girl’s face light up as she samples it too. This small adventure not only breaks your routine but recharges your spirit and makes you see the beauty in everyday interactions and the simple pleasures of life.
So next time you feel like life is just about going through the motions, remember that the world is brimming with beauty, charm, and adventure. You just have to be open to seeing it. Seek out new experiences, cherish the moments of wonder, and let the world's charm infuse a sense of adventure into your daily life.
